How Mega Millions Works
The mechanics of Mega Millions are straightforward, making it accessible to anyone who wants to get involved. Players should choose five numbers from a swimming pool of white balls numbered 1 through 70, and one additional number called the Mega Ball from a separate swimming pool of gold balls numbered 1 through 25. To win the jackpot, a player must match all six numbers drawn throughout the official drawing. Nevertheless, there are multiple prize tiers, implying gamers can win considerable quantities even without matching all numbers.
Illustrations take place twice weekly, supplying routine opportunities for participants to check their luck. The anticipation between drawings produces a repeating cycle of excitement and hope that keeps gamers engaged. Each illustration is performed with rigorous security steps and openness protocols to ensure fairness and keep public trust in the game’s integrity.
The odds of winning vary depending upon the prize tier. While the chances of striking it rich are admittedly steep, the game provides 9 different methods to win rewards. This multi-tier structure indicates that even if gamers do not win the grand reward, they still have opportunities to win smaller sized however still substantial quantities. This design aspect contributes to the video game’s sustained appeal, as it offers more regular wins that keep gamers motivated and engaged.
The Prize Structure and Payouts
Mega Millions includes an extensive reward structure that rewards various levels of number matching. The jackpot, which starts at a considerable base quantity, represents the supreme reward for matching all 5 white balls plus the Mega Ball. When somebody wins the jackpot, it resets to the starting quantity for the next drawing. If no one wins, the jackpot rolls over, including more money to the prize pool for the subsequent drawing.
Beyond the jackpot, there are 8 additional prize tiers. Matching five white balls without the Mega Ball normally grants a substantial second-tier prize. The remaining reward levels represent numerous mixes of matched white balls and the Mega Ball, with rewards decreasing as fewer numbers are matched. Even matching just the Mega Ball alone leads to a small reward, ensuring that the game provides worth at several levels.
Winners face an essential decision relating to how they receive their jackpot: as an annuity paid over numerous years or as a lump sum cash payment. The annuity choice supplies the full marketed jackpot amount distributed in yearly installations, with each payment increasing slightly to account for inflation. The cash alternative provides immediate access to the reward but at a minimized quantity, usually representing the real cash in the reward swimming pool. Each alternative has unique financial ramifications, and winners typically consult with financial consultants to identify the very best choice for their circumstances.
The Mathematics Behind the Game
Comprehending the mathematical possibility of Mega Millions helps gamers approach the video game with sensible expectations. The odds of winning the jackpot are approximately 1 in 302 million, reflecting the enormous variety of possible number mixes. These odds, while daunting, are in fact what allow the prizes to grow to such remarkable sizes, as the rarity of jackpot wins enables prizes to accumulate over numerous illustrations.
The chances improve significantly for lower reward tiers. For example, matching 5 white balls has chances of roughly 1 in 12.6 million, while matching 4 white balls plus the Mega Ball has odds of about 1 in 931,000. The total chances of winning any prize in Mega Millions are approximately 1 in 24, making smaller sized wins reasonably typical and maintaining player interest in between major jackpot events.
These mathematical realities highlight an important principle: lottery video games need to be considered as entertainment rather than financial investment techniques. The unfavorable anticipated worth indicates that, usually, gamers will spend more on tickets than they get in payouts. However, the home entertainment worth, the excitement of participation, and the possibility of a life-altering win offer intangible advantages that numerous discover worthwhile.
Techniques and Myths
Many gamers develop personal strategies for selecting numbers, though it’s important to understand that Mega Millions is a video game of pure opportunity. Some choose choosing considerable dates like birthdays and anniversaries, while others opt for random choices or utilize different numerical patterns. From a mathematical viewpoint, no selection method increases the probability of winning, as each number mix has an equal possibility of being drawn.
One factor to consider worth noting is that choosing popular number combinations, such as sequences or frequently chosen numbers, doesn’t lower your opportunities of winning however might indicate sharing the jackpot with more people if those numbers are drawn. Conversely, picking less common number combinations won’t enhance your odds of winning but could lead to a bigger private payment if you do win, as you ‘d be less likely to divide the reward.
Numerous myths surround lottery video games, and Mega Millions is no exception. Some believe that specific numbers are “due” to be drawn based on past results, but each illustration is an independent occasion with no connection to previous results. Other misconceptions recommend that particular retailers or places are “luckier” than others, however this understanding generally results from greater sales volume at those locations instead of any real advantage.
The Social and Economic Impact
Mega Millions produces significant revenue, with a significant part designated to different public functions. While the exact distribution differs by jurisdiction, lottery proceeds typically support education, facilities, environmental programs, and other public initiatives. This element allows players to feel that their involvement adds to neighborhood advantages, even when they do not win rewards.
The economic impact extends beyond public financing. Large jackpots create financial activity through increased ticket sales, media coverage, and public interest. Retailers benefit from commissions on ticket sales and rewards for selling winning tickets. The enjoyment surrounding major jackpots can produce a short-lived increase in regional economies as people collect to purchase tickets and discuss the possibilities.
Nevertheless, lottery games likewise raise crucial social considerations. Critics point to concerns about issue gaming and the regressive nature of lottery participation, noting that lower-income people typically spend an out of proportion percentage of their income on tickets. These concerns have caused increased focus on responsible gaming messages and resources for those who may develop unhealthy betting practices.
